Loading older firmware

Selecting older firmware

When working in an existing system, it can be wise to replace the firmware in a device with an older version:

  • In an existing KNX system, an existing device is to be replaced with a new device, which was delivered with a newer firmware version. Here, the current firmware version of the new device can be replaced with the older version already used in the KNX system. Thus, there is no need to change the configuration existing in the ETS project.
  • A KNX system, in which an older KNX Data Secure Specification is used, is to be expanded. The device to be added to this system is delivered with firmware supporting a newer KNX Data Secure Specification. If older firmware, which supports the KNX Data Secure Specification already used in the KNX installation, is to be loaded to the new device, then all the other devices can be left unchanged.

It is possible that a certain older firmware version may not be loaded in devices with a newer firmware version. This information is saved in the data containers. The app only makes firmware versions available which may be loaded into a device.

Devices can be selected within the device list. Only the selected devices are included in the further procedure of the device downgrade.

If only one device is selected in the device list (left column of the user interface), the Stiliger Service App displays the currently installed firmware version in the central column Device Update, along with all the additionally available firmware versions. The newest available firmware is selected automatically here. When downgrading to older firmware, then a version must be selected here manually that is older than the firmware installed during the factory delivery.

Downgrade warning

Loading an older firmware undoes both functional enhancements and error corrections contained in the previously loaded, more current firmware. This can lead to malfunctions and safety deficiencies. For this reason, the Stiliger Service App displays a warning before activating the older firmware.

If multiple devices are selected (irrespective of whether they are the same or different device type), the Stiliger Service App always reverts to the current firmware version. It is not then possible to select other versions (and thus also not select older firmware).

The Release Notes column on the right displays information on the selected version.

After older firmware has been loaded, the device must also be commissioned with the ETS (programming of the physical address and the application program).
